Arrests:9:45pm Maynard & Gladstone D.U.ISeveral loud crashes woke up neighbors who looked out their windows to see several damaged cars. The police were called and Ingleside Officers Young and Dedet were soon on scene. They found the driver of the first vehicle stumbling around with the strong odor of alcohol. The driver of another vehicle identified the suspect as the one who hit him as well as several parked cars. Young and Dedet asked the driver of the first car to take a field sobriety test. He refused. They asked him to take a breath alcohol test. Again, he refused. The officers obtained a search warrant from a judge who granted their request. The suspect was taken to Mission Station where a phlebotomist drew samples for later testing. The suspect then was taken to the county jail and booked for driving under the influence. Report number: 170396840Serious Incidents:3:20am 1500 Blk. Guerrero RobberyTwo men and a woman, sitting on the front steps of a home, and waiting for an Uber ride, were robbed. The victim’s said three men walked up and demanded their property. One of the victims stood up to the suspects. But, that defiance didn’t stop the robbery. One of the suspects swung at one of the victims and hit her in the chest. The suspects then took a shoulder bag from one victim and ran to a waiting car which sped away north on Guerrero. The loss was a wallet, keys, debit card, and cash.
